当前位置: 首页 > news >正文

黑马程序员微信小程序学习总结6.页面导航

目录

  • 页面导航
    • 声明式导航
      • 导航到tabBar页面
      • 导航到非tabBar页面
      • 后退导航
      • 传参
    • 编程式导航
      • 导航到tabBar页面
      • 导航到非tabBar页面
      • 后退导航
      • 传参

页面导航

在这里插入图片描述

声明式导航

导航到tabBar页面

在这里插入图片描述
例子:
在这里插入图片描述

导航到非tabBar页面

在这里插入图片描述
在这里插入图片描述

后退导航

在这里插入图片描述

传参

在这里插入图片描述

注意:此方法只能用于非tabBar页面
如果tabBar页面使用,option会为空。因为switchTab会导致页面跳转到指定的页面并切换至底部的选项卡(tabBar),并且会清除页面栈中的所有页面,这意味着页面的生命周期函数onLoad不会被触发,因为页面并没有实际被销毁和重新加载。可以通过事件传递和全局变量的方式传参

页面取参:
在这里插入图片描述

编程式导航

在这里插入图片描述

导航到tabBar页面

在这里插入图片描述
在这里插入图片描述

导航到非tabBar页面

在这里插入图片描述
在这里插入图片描述

后退导航

在这里插入图片描述
在这里插入图片描述

传参

在这里插入图片描述

取参数:
在这里插入图片描述
获取后可以放到页面的data数据中以便其他地方使用

相关文章:

  • 【实训】自动运维ansible实训(网络管理与维护综合实训)
  • 小程序支付类型接入京东支付
  • JUnit
  • Hadoop3.x基础(4)- Yarn
  • Backtrader 文档学习- Sizers
  • Centos7.9安装SQLserver2017数据库
  • Java基于微信小程序的医院核酸检测服务系统,附源码
  • Android:ViewAdapter
  • RabbitMQ_00000
  • 开发实践11_Blog
  • 【Java数据结构】ArrayList和LinkedList的遍历
  • 数据结构-->线性表-->顺序表
  • Tkinter教程21:Listbox列表框+OptionMenu选项菜单+Combobox下拉列表框控件的使用+绑定事件
  • 类与对象(终章)——友元,内部类,匿名对象
  • 【Unity3D小技巧】Unity3D中UI控制解决方案
  • Google 是如何开发 Web 框架的
  • ES6语法详解(一)
  • iOS帅气加载动画、通知视图、红包助手、引导页、导航栏、朋友圈、小游戏等效果源码...
  • iOS小技巧之UIImagePickerController实现头像选择
  • js作用域和this的理解
  • Linux中的硬链接与软链接
  • Spring Boot快速入门(一):Hello Spring Boot
  • spring学习第二天
  • 解析 Webpack中import、require、按需加载的执行过程
  • 理清楚Vue的结构
  • 你真的知道 == 和 equals 的区别吗?
  • 前端相关框架总和
  • 我看到的前端
  • 在electron中实现跨域请求,无需更改服务器端设置
  • 怎么把视频里的音乐提取出来
  • d²y/dx²; 偏导数问题 请问f1 f2是什么意思
  • linux 淘宝开源监控工具tsar
  • ​Java并发新构件之Exchanger
  • ​sqlite3 --- SQLite 数据库 DB-API 2.0 接口模块​
  • # .NET Framework中使用命名管道进行进程间通信
  • %3cli%3e连接html页面,html+canvas实现屏幕截取
  • (2)Java 简介
  • (C语言)二分查找 超详细
  • (PyTorch)TCN和RNN/LSTM/GRU结合实现时间序列预测
  • (大众金融)SQL server面试题(1)-总销售量最少的3个型号的车及其总销售量
  • (二)windows配置JDK环境
  • (二)学习JVM —— 垃圾回收机制
  • (附源码)springboot 基于HTML5的个人网页的网站设计与实现 毕业设计 031623
  • (附源码)springboot课程在线考试系统 毕业设计 655127
  • (生成器)yield与(迭代器)generator
  • (十三)Maven插件解析运行机制
  • (续)使用Django搭建一个完整的项目(Centos7+Nginx)
  • (一)Spring Cloud 直击微服务作用、架构应用、hystrix降级
  • (一一四)第九章编程练习
  • **PHP分步表单提交思路(分页表单提交)
  • .desktop 桌面快捷_Linux桌面环境那么多,这几款优秀的任你选
  • .jks文件(JAVA KeyStore)
  • .net 8 发布了,试下微软最近强推的MAUI
  • .NET Entity FrameWork 总结 ,在项目中用处个人感觉不大。适合初级用用,不涉及到与数据库通信。
  • .NET 中什么样的类是可使用 await 异步等待的?